Account Representative position will be in the Intermountain Region i.e. Nevada, Idaho, Utah, Arizona, Colorado, and New Mexico. Employee needs to be self-directed and work with little to no daily supervision or oversight. Communication skills and working with end users is key to our success in maintaining and growing our current business. Computer skills and providing daily reports to the mine operators and drilling contractors is a must. 75% of the job will be in the field providing BSS equipment and drilling fluids support on mining exploration, dewatering programs, surface, and underground drilling operations on active mine sites in Nevada and Intermountain Region.
There will also be support provided for water wells and infrastructure projects as well as industry trade shows, customer schools, continuing education classes. Baroid IDP’s typical markets and drilling disciplines served are Wireline Coring, Direct Mud Rotary, Reverse Circulation, Flooded Reverse, Direct Air, Horizontal Directional, and all manner of Construction Drilling including Slurry Wall, Drilled Shaft, HDD, and Tunnelling/Micro-Tunnelling. Working with and calling on our distribution network in the region is expected on a regular basis. Calls after normal business hours and on weekends are common. Schedule will be largely determined by workload demand and the employee’s discretion but would rarely exceed more than a 10/4.
Working conditions will be in remote, high-altitude environments with exposure to changing weather conditions throughout the year. Driving will be a daily requirement along with overnight stays. Compliance with the company driving policies, vehicle operation and maintenance requirements is a must. Employee will need to obtain initial MSHA training for surface and underground and maintain annual MSHA refresher and comply with mine site-specific training requirements. Company assigned training will also need to be maintained as required.
